Review comment:
       In the case where there are no overUtilizedNodes in the cluster. Only 
underUtilizedNodes and other nodes having utilization within the limits are 
present. Then underUtilizedNodes need to be balanced and become the source 
nodes to which data will be moved. 
   
   So here the term 'source nodes' has been used for nodes that need to be 
balanced. Target nodes will be chosen from the list of over, above average, 
under or below average nodes as necessary. Do you have another approach in mind?
